Compliance requirements:
- Fair Work Act 2009 (Cth) - relating to employee entitlements and allowances.
- Work Health and Safety Act 2011 (NSW) - requiring expenses on safety equipment and training.
- Building and Construction Industry Security of Payment Act 1999 (NSW) - impacting payment claims and dispute resolution expenses.
- Receipt retention: 5 years
Tax note: Under Australian Taxation Law (specifically Income Tax Assessment Act 1997), businesses can deduct expenses incurred in gaining or producing assessable income, provided they are not capital, private or domestic in nature. A crucial aspect is substantiation - receipts and records are paramount to claim deductions for business expenses like materials and sub-contractor payments.
